The Columbus Junior High School Cross Country Team wrapped up their 2024 season, October 10, at the Pleasanton Junior High Meet. Eli Engleman placed eighth in the seventh grade boys race and Sammi Ohmart took first place in the seventh grade girls event. Sammi placed first in four of the six meets in her rookie season and was second at the Columbus Invitational. Eli placed in the top ten at five races in his inaugural junior high season and was 14th at Columbus. Courtesy photo.

The Kansas State High School Activities Association has implemented a new format for the 2024 high school volleyball post season. Sixteen teams will play in a four-quad formatted tournament per a statement released by KSHSAA early this year.

Lady Titans 3-1A State bound

The Columbus Lady Titan Golf Team qualified for the Kansas Class 3-1A State Tournament by placing third as a team the Caney Valley 3-1A Regional Tournament, Monday.Senior, Mallory Thompson, led the Lady Titans by placing seventh in a field of 46 golfers from 15 schools.

CJHS Seventh falls to Comets

The Columbus Seventh Grade Titans suffered a 6-14 loss on the road in Chanute, Thursday.The Junior Comets got on the score board with a pair of passes in the second quarter. The first, a 30-yard toss and the second a 20-yard catch andrun.

Titan Eighth cages Lions

The Columbus Titan Eight Graders blanked Baxter Springs, Thursday, at Titan Stadium, 32-0. The home team took control early with a 44-yard touchdown run by Jayden Dohle in the first quarter. Paxton Schalk ran in the two-point conversion for an 8-0 lead.

Titans shutout Rams in CNC tussle

A 62-yard kickoff return by Titan Freshman, Cole Howard, a pair of interceptions and fumble recoveryby freshman, Kash Smith, set the tone for the Columbus Titan Offense in the 36-0, shutout over the Riverton Rams on Senior Night in Riverton, Friday.
